How point of sale marketing material can help to grow your sales Every retailer and every company selling consumer goods understands how critical point of sale marketing is to driving in-store sales. In the food & beverage services sector, hot coffee sits at the top of consumer planned purchases which means the point of purchase drivers need to include visibility, price, promotion, and of course persuasion via store staff. Visibility and promotion is supported by well positioned Point of Sale marketing materials and influence buying behaviour. Staff persuasion can be supported by way of suggestive selling and/or sampling. Here are some examples, “Hi, have you tried our coffee? Can I shout you one today?”, or “Did you know

we also sell great coffee?” When we work in our businesses day and night, sometimes we forget to take a step back and view our branding and products from the eyes of our customers. Some of the questions you can ask yourself include: Is our signage clearly visible from the passers-by? When my customers approach my front door, can they clearly see what products I have on offer? It is proven that point of sale materials at eyelevel or lower have more chance of being noticed. Article: ever wondered why coffee is called ‘cup of joe’? Almost everyone knows that another term for coffee is “Joe”. But coffee is also known affectionately by many other phrases around the world as well. In Australia, specifically, we tend to give nicknames to those we love, and considering we have such a love affair with coffee, it is no wonder it is called a myriad of different phrases. For example, across the western world, in fact, coffee is called a range of terms, such as brew, mud, java, dirt, jitter juice and rocket fuel, to name a few. Despite the many nicknames that coffee has been labelled with, it is perhaps the term Joe that most people associate with coffee. We hear it in American movies time and time again. The guy walks into the local diner and asks the server, “Give me a cup of Joe and a piece of that peach pie, Sal”. But, have you ever wondered where the term “Joe” came from? Well, many have wondered just that. And there has been much speculation and many theories have come to light on the term’s origin as well. Legend has it that the term Cup of Joe originated around the 1930 era. Some suggest the term Joe originated from the fact that coffee was seen as a drink of the masses, the average person, the average Joe. It became accessible to all and became the most popular drink in America. Others suggest that Joe originated from the words Java and Mocha, upon making the word Jamoke. Then there is the theory that coffee was referred to as a Cup of George / Cup of Geo in WW1 after the name of the company that supplied it, which in turn led to the phrase Cup of Joe due to Geo being read as Joe. Another suggestion relates to the U.S. Navy and the banning of alcohol. Due to this, the sailors had to resort to coffee, the drink with the next biggest kick, and the Cup of Joe was thus named after the individual who banned it in the first place (i.e. Josephus Daniels). Despite all these theories of its origin, the most popular alternative phrase for coffee – Cup of Joe – has surely stuck. All these decades after it first originated, the good ole cup of Joe, doesn’t look to be going anywhere and certainly won’t be turning into a Cup of Bob anytime soon!

Why do we charge gst on our milk?

On trend

Many of you have asked us why we charge GST on our milk. The reason is this; the Milk Powder is made from milk solids with free flowing agents added to make it compatible in a vending machine, therefore it is not GST FREE.
